欢迎来到天天文库
浏览记录
ID:46570739
大小:605.50 KB
页数:21页
时间:2019-11-25
《第三讲_数字签名技术与应用》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、第3章数字签名技术与应用3.1数字签名的基本原理3.2常规数字签名方法3.3特殊数字签名方法3.4美国数字签名标准3.5分析评价目录2信息管理与信息系统崔基哲引例:B2B网上交易平台对文件进行加密只解决了传送信息的保密问题,防止他人对传输的文件进行破坏以及如何确定发信人的身份还需要采取其他的手段,这一手段就是数字签名。3信息管理与信息系统崔基哲3.1数字签名的基本原理3.1.1数字签名的要求3.1.2数字签名的分类3.1.3数字签名的使用3.1.4数字签名与手写签名的区别4信息管理与信息系统崔基哲数字签名是指伴随着数字化编码的消息一起发送并与发送的消息有一定逻辑关联
2、的数据项,借助数字签名可以确定消息的发送方,同时还可以确定消息自发出后未被修改过。3.1数字签名的基本原理5信息管理与信息系统崔基哲3.1.1数字签名的要求接收方能够确认或证实发送方的签名,但不能伪造发送方发出签名的消息至接收方后,就不能再否认他所签发的消息接收方对已收到的签名消息不能否认,即有收到认证第三者可以确认接收方和发送方之间的消息传送,但不能伪造这一过程3.1数字签名的基本原理6信息管理与信息系统崔基哲3.1数字签名的基本原理基于签字内容的分类对整体消息的签字对压缩消息的签字基于数学难题的分类基于对离散对数问题的签名方案基于素因子分解问题的签名方案两者结合
3、基于签名用户的分类单个用户签名多个用户签名3.1.2数字签名的分类基于数字签名所具有特性的分类不具有自动恢复特性的数字签名方案具有消息自动恢复特性的数字签名方案基于数字签名所涉及的通信角色分类直接数字签名方案需仲裁的数字签名方案7信息管理与信息系统崔基哲3.1.3数字签名的使用3.1数字签名的基本原理8信息管理与信息系统崔基哲3.1.4数字签名与手写签名的区别数字签名vs.手写签名数字签名vs.消息认证3.1数字签名的基本原理9信息管理与信息系统崔基哲3.2常规数字签名方法3.2.1RSA签名3.2.2EIGamal签名10信息管理与信息系统崔基哲3.2.1RSA签
4、名简化的RSA数字签名模式3.2常规数字签名方法11信息管理与信息系统崔基哲3.2.1RSA签名利用散列函数进行数字签名3.2常规数字签名方法12信息管理与信息系统崔基哲3.2.2EIGamal签名1.EIGamal算法参数说明2.签名及验证过程3.2常规数字签名方法13信息管理与信息系统崔基哲3.3特殊数字签名方法3.3.1盲签名3.3.2多重签名3.3.3代理签名3.3.4定向签名3.3.5双联签名3.3.6团体签名3.3.7不可争辩签名14信息管理与信息系统崔基哲3.3.1盲签名盲签名消息盲参数签名弱盲签名强盲签名3.3特殊数字签名方法15信息管理与信息系统崔
5、基哲3.3.2多重签名3.3.3代理签名代理签名是指原签名者将自己的签名权委托给可靠的代理人,让代理人代表本人去行使某些权力。3.3特殊数字签名方法16信息管理与信息系统崔基哲3.3.3代理签名1.代理签名的基本要求签名容易验证原签名者与代理签名者的签名容易区分签名事实不可否认3.3特殊数字签名方法17信息管理与信息系统崔基哲3.3.3代理签名2.几种代理签名方案介绍一次性代理签名方案代理多重签名代理多重签名是指某人同时受多人委托进行代理签名。盲代理签名3.3特殊数字签名方法18信息管理与信息系统崔基哲3.3.4定向签名3.3.5双联签名3.3特殊数字签名方法19信
6、息管理与信息系统崔基哲3.3.6团体签名1.团体签名的特性2.T的团体签名方案3.3.7不可争辩签名不可争辩签名是指没有签名者的合作不可能验证签名的签名。3.3特殊数字签名方法20信息管理与信息系统崔基哲3.4美国数字签名标准3.4.1美国数字签名标准简介3.4.2数字签名算法(DSA)21信息管理与信息系统崔基哲
此文档下载收益归作者所有